Wait for CI
This skill blocks until CI either passes or fails on the current PR using a single blocking command.
Usage
Run this command to block until CI completes:
gh pr checks --watch --fail-fast
This command will:
- Block until all CI checks complete
- Exit with code 0 if all checks pass
- Exit with non-zero code and stop early (
--fail-fast) if any check fails
Handling "no checks" case
If CI hasn't started yet, the command may return immediately with "no checks reported". In that case, wait briefly and retry:
sleep 30 && gh pr checks --watch --fail-fast
If after 2 attempts (about 1 minute total) there are still no checks, one of the following is true:
- You have merge conflicts. Resolve them and then start the CI wait again.
- Your changes are not triggering CI. Check the GitHub Actions setup to confirm nothing will have triggered. If true, you can consider CI green.
- GitHub is having issues. Check status.github.com to verify. If true, bail out and let the user know they'll need to try again when GitHub is back.
